DO NOT COME HERE FOR GROOMING. I brought one of my Maine Coons in for a wash and shave. I paid over $100 just to have him sedated. Pick up is done in the parking lot so you don't have a chance to examine the groom, so I only noticed the issues when I arrived home. First his nails were clipped (I asked them not to) and they were clipped so low they had bled and my cat walked with a limp for DAYS. How do you cut nails too low when a cat is asleep??? And lastly when I let him out of our crate at home he had rock hard, gray clumps of something in his tail and stuck all over the bottoms of his feet and between his toes. I had to CUT OUT the clumps from his tail and soak his feet to remove whatever this was. This groom totaled $200. I contacted the office manager who said he would not refund me or compensate me for the issues. Smh. I paid all that money to have to clean him up AFTER the groomers. Never again will I go to Town and Country. Learn from my experience, and steer clear.

Town & Country West is conveniently located on the intersection of Macland Rd. & Powder Springs Rd SW in Marietta. The clinic has 6 veterinarians and they are all wonderful. They are very caring, compassionate, understanding, knowledgeable but most importantly honest. They offer full veterinary services for small pets and also Boarding and Grooming. Regarding some vet services offered, they do wellness exams, vaccinations, ultrasounds, digital X- rays, microchipping, blood work, cold laser therapy and more... All their employees are drug tested and they are very kind... I highly recommend Town & Country West Veterinary Clinic...
